It depends on what type of roadway. There is Asphalt which is made from stones, sand, and gravel held together by asphalt cement. There are also roadways made from Concrete is consists of gravel, fine sand, and cement (which is composed of ash and limestone).

What are contact surfaces of relay contactorsand starters made of?

Contact surfaces of relay contactors and starters are often made of materials such as silver, silver alloy, or silver cadmium oxide. These materials provide good electrical conductivity, resistance to arcing and welding, and durability for repeated operations.

What makes the sticky side of tape, sticky?

The stickiness of tape comes from the adhesive coating applied to one side. This adhesive is usually made from materials like rubber, acrylic, or silicone that create a bond with surfaces through intermolecular forces. The stickiness allows the tape to adhere to different surfaces when pressure is applied.
